Safety and Pregnancy Outcomes in Thrombocythemia Patients Exposed to XAGRID® (Anagrelide Hydrochloride) Compared to Other Treatments

A Non-Interventional, Post Authorisation Safety Study, to Continuously Monitor Safety and Pregnancy Outcomes in a Cohort of At-Risk Essential Thrombocythaemia (ET) Subjects Exposed to Xagrid Compared to Other Conventional Cytoreductive Treatments

Brief summary

This is an observational safety study being conducted in Europe comparing patients taking Xagrid to patients taking other cytoreductive treatments. The plan is to enrol at least 750 subjects taking Xagrid with up to 3000 subjects taking other cytoreductive therapies. The study will collect follow up data for 5 years for each patient enrolled that will focus on collecting data related to pre-defined events (PDEs) and Suspected Serious Adverse Reactions (SSARs).

Percentage of Participants With At Least One Pre-Defined Event (PDE), Deaths, PregnanciesUp to 5 yearsPre-defined events (PDEs) were evaluated whenever an event occurred and was defined by a panel of independent qualified physicians, blinded to cytoreductive therapy, validated all PDEs prior to analysis (Event Validation Panel). Non-PDE death only included deaths not recorded as outcome of another PDE.
Number of Participants With Suspected Serious Adverse Reaction (SSAR) EventsUp to 5 yearsSSAR: serious adverse event (SAE) that was considered related to cytoreductive therapy. SAE: any untoward medical occurrence that at any dose resulted in death, life-threatening (at the time of the event), in-patient hospitalization/prolongation of existing hospitalization (elective hospitalizations/procedures for pre-existing conditions that had not worsened were excluded), resulted in persistent or significant disability/incapacity or congenital abnormality/birth defect. Relatedness (suspected/not suspected) to XAGRID or other cytoreductive theraphy was determined by the investigator. As for SSARs, it was important to consider whether the events were related to XAGRID or other cytoreductive therapy. A participant was included in Xagrid or other treatment group based on treatment exposure, participants received Xagrid + Other was counted both in Xagrid and other treatment group.

Event Rate of Thrombohaemorrhagic EventsUp to 5 yearsEvent Rate of Thrombohaemorrhagic Events was calculated by dividing number of participants with events by total patient-year exposure. The reporting unit is per 100 participant-years of treatment exposure. Thrombohaemorrhagic Events is a composite endpoint of the PDEs myocardial infarction, angina, stroke, transient ischaemic attack, venous thromboembolic events, intermittent claudication/digital ischaemia, and major haemorrhagic events.

Participants who were newly diagnosed (received no treatment at the time of study registration) or previously diagnosed with essential thrombocythemia (ET), receiving or continuing previous cytoreductive therapy were recruited in the study

Pre-assignment details

Due to the non-interventional nature of the study, participants could be receiving XAGRID, XAGRID+Other (Cytoreductives), other (cytoreductives) and no essential thrombocythemia (ET) therapy. During the study participants could change the treatments.

Secondary

Event Rate of Thrombohaemorrhagic Events

Event Rate of Thrombohaemorrhagic Events was calculated by dividing number of participants with events by total patient-year exposure. The reporting unit is per 100 participant-years of treatment exposure. Thrombohaemorrhagic Events is a composite endpoint of the PDEs myocardial infarction, angina, stroke, transient ischaemic attack, venous thromboembolic events, intermittent claudication/digital ischaemia, and major haemorrhagic events.

Time frame: Up to 5 years

Population: Overall Treatment Safety Population. As participant could switch between therapies a participant with an event could be allocated to more than one therapy group. Participants analyzed included who were exposed to the specific treatment any time during the study.

ArmMeasureValue (NUMBER)
XAGRID OnlyEvent Rate of Thrombohaemorrhagic Events2.75 participants/100 participant-years
XAGRID+Other (Cytoreductives)Event Rate of Thrombohaemorrhagic Events2.86 participants/100 participant-years
Other (Cytoreductives)Event Rate of Thrombohaemorrhagic Events2.60 participants/100 participant-years
No Essential Thrombocythemia (ET) TherapyEvent Rate of Thrombohaemorrhagic Events4.91 participants/100 participant-years
